From ee306a9f07dcc0f0b492446eed28976f9dd2e3dd Mon Sep 17 00:00:00 2001 From: rogerman Date: Tue, 10 Jan 2017 10:42:08 -0800 Subject: [PATCH] Cocoa Port: Disable the default clipping feature in display views as a micro optimization. --- .../frontend/cocoa/userinterface/DisplayWindowController.mm |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/desmume/src/frontend/cocoa/userinterface/DisplayWindowController.mm b/desmume/src/frontend/cocoa/userinterface/DisplayWindowController.mm index 79d4cb571..6c68d73ff 100644 --- a/desmume/src/frontend/cocoa/userinterface/DisplayWindowController.mm +++ b/desmume/src/frontend/cocoa/userinterface/DisplayWindowController.mm @@ -1885,6 +1885,11 @@ static std::unordered_map _screenMap; // return YES; } +- (BOOL)wantsDefaultClipping +{ + return NO; +} + - (void)lockFocus { [super lockFocus];